Biography

Overview

Gabe Evans is a Republican U.S. Representative from Colorado's 8th congressional district, serving since 2025. He is a former U.S. Army captain with the Colorado National Guard and former Arvada Police Department lieutenant with law enforcement and military background. Evans is a member of the moderate Republican Governance Group and serves on the House Energy and Commerce and Homeland Security committees.

Career

In his first year in Congress, Evans has focused on law enforcement and national security issues. Two of his bills advanced through House committees in April 2025: the Law Enforcement Support and Counter Transnational Repression Accountability Act to address foreign government repression of diaspora communities, and the Expediting Federal Broadband Deployment Reviews Act to streamline broadband permitting for rural and underserved areas. He also voted in favor of the Laken Riley Act.

Prior political experience

Evans was first elected to Congress in November 2024, defeating incumbent Democratic Representative Yadira Caraveo. He previously served in the Colorado House of Representatives, where he received 63.31% of votes cast in the 2022 election. In the 2024 Republican primary for his congressional seat, he defeated former Colorado State Representative Janak Joshi.
